The Problem with Standard Hardscape Materials in Southlake
Before understanding why Unilock pavers are gaining ground, it helps to understand where the standard material options consistently fall short in the Southlake environment.
Stamped Concrete Looks Good Once
Stamped concrete is the most commonly specified decorative hardscape surface across DFW's residential market. It is poured as one slab, stamped with a pattern that mimics stone or brick, colored, and sealed. On installation day it can look genuinely impressive. Within a few years in Southlake's conditions, the picture changed considerably.
North Texas clay soil expands when saturated and contracts when it dries. A concrete slab has no tolerance for that movement. It cracks, and in DFW's climate it almost always cracks sooner than the homeowner expects. When the slab cracks, the only real repair is to remove the affected section and repour it, which never matches the color and pattern of the original pour perfectly. Stamped concrete patios in Southlake that are five or six years old rarely look like they did on installation day.
Standard Brick Pavers Are Widely Available but Not Premium
Standard concrete brick pavers solve the cracking problem that stamped concrete creates. Individual pavers can shift slightly with soil movement without cracking, and individual units can be removed and reset if a section develops a problem. For these reasons, brick pavers are a genuine improvement over poured concrete in North Texas conditions.
What brick pavers do not offer is the design range, the surface technology, or the material performance that the Southlake luxury market expects. Standard brick pavers come in a limited range of colors that tend to fade under sustained UV exposure. They lack the surface treatments that prevent staining. Their dimensional tolerances produce less precise joint spacing than engineered concrete paver products. On a Timarron or Carillon estate property where the outdoor hardscape is expected to reflect the same standard as the home's architecture, standard brick pavers consistently produce a result that looks fine but does not look genuinely premium.
Natural Stone Has Character but Also Has Maintenance
Natural limestone, travertine, and flagstone are the premium material choices that Southlake homeowners have historically turned to when standard pavers feel insufficient. Natural stone has genuine character, warmth, and authenticity that manufactured products cannot fully replicate. It also has real limitations in a North Texas outdoor environment.
Natural stone is porous and stains more readily than engineered concrete paver products, particularly around outdoor kitchens and pool areas where food, oils, and pool chemicals are part of daily use. It requires periodic sealing to maintain stain resistance and appearance. It varies in thickness, which creates installation challenges for achieving consistent surface levels. And at the price points natural stone commands in Southlake, the maintenance commitment it requires is not always what luxury homeowners want from their outdoor hardscape investment.
What Unilock Pavers Actually Offer
Unilock pavers are engineered concrete pavers manufactured to standards that exceed what standard brick paver products deliver in every measurable performance dimension.
EnduraColor for Lasting Color Performance
Unilock's EnduraColor technology blends pigment through the full depth of the paver rather than applying color only to the surface layer. This means UV exposure does not fade the color of a Unilock paver in the way it fades surface-colored pavers over time. The paver in year ten looks significantly closer to the paver on installation day than a standard brick paver or stamped concrete surface of the same age.
For Southlake's UV environment, where outdoor surfaces receive intense direct sun exposure for eight to nine months of the year, this color stability is a meaningful performance advantage that is visible over time rather than only on paper.
EasyClean Stain Protection Built Into the Surface
Unilock's EasyClean technology is built into the paver surface during manufacturing. It reduces the penetration of everyday outdoor spills into the paver material before they can develop into permanent stains. For a Southlake patio adjacent to an outdoor kitchen or pool deck where food oils, wine, sunscreen, and pool chemicals are part of daily outdoor use, a surface that resists staining without requiring constant sealing attention is a practical advantage that compounds over the life of the installation.
Standard brick pavers and natural stone both require periodic sealing to maintain stain resistance. Unilock's EasyClean does not eliminate the need for appropriate care but it significantly reduces the maintenance burden compared to unsealed alternatives.
A Design Range That Standard Pavers Cannot Match
Unilock's paver product range covers contemporary smooth-surface collections like Umbriano, European cobblestone collections like Courtstone, natural stone-look collections like Beacon Hill Flagstone, and dedicated pool deck and driveway product ranges. The full range spans every architectural character from the clean modern lines of a contemporary Southlake home to the warm transitional character of a Mediterranean-inspired estate in Carillon.
Standard brick pavers offer a fraction of this design range. The ability to specify a Unilock product that genuinely complements the home's architectural character rather than simply being the available paver option is one of the reasons Southlake homeowners at the top of the market are making the switch.
Dimensional Precision for Better Finished Results
Unilock pavers are manufactured to tighter dimensional tolerances than standard brick pavers. This means more consistent joint spacing, more precise pattern alignment, and cleaner edge conditions at material transitions. The difference is visible in the finished installation, particularly on large patio surfaces and pool decks where dimensional inconsistency across hundreds of pavers becomes a visible pattern that reduces the quality of the finished result.

The Certified Contractor Difference
Unilock's Authorized Contractor program gives Southlake homeowners a way to identify installers who have been vetted and approved by Unilock directly. Authorization requires verified project references, proof of insurance, and demonstrated installation standards before it is granted. Unilock backs the workmanship of every Authorized Contractor installation with a 2-year Peace of Mind guarantee.
In a market where contractor quality varies significantly and where the difference between a correctly installed Unilock paver system and an incorrectly installed one is not visible on day one but becomes very visible over the following seasons, working with a Unilock Authorized Contractor is not just a credential preference. It is the practical assurance that the installation will be done to the standard the product requires.

The Investment Case for Unilock Pavers in Southlake
Initial Cost vs Long-Term Value
Unilock pavers carry a higher initial material cost than standard brick pavers and a comparable initial cost to quality natural stone. The investment case is built on long-term performance rather than day-one price comparison. The color stability, stain resistance, dimensional precision, and workmanship guarantee that Unilock pavers produce a hardscape surface that looks significantly better in year ten than either standard brick pavers or stamped concrete of the same age, at a maintenance cost that is lower than natural stone alternatives.
What the Complete Project Looks Like
A complete Unilock paver patio, pool deck, and driveway project on a Southlake estate property ranges from $30,000 for a defined patio area with quality materials and proper base preparation to $120,000 and above for a complete system covering the driveway, motor court, patio, pool deck, and approach walkways in coordinated Unilock products designed as one complete outdoor hardscape environment.
